reg 70 Entitlement to witness expenses

(1) Where any person is— (a) notified under rule 62 of the requirement to give evidence in any proceedings, or (b) served with a witness summons issued under rule 63 or 65, there shall be paid or tendered to him at that time any expenses in respect of his attendance. (2) For the purpose of this rule— (a) the tender of a warrant or voucher entitling a person to travel free of charge shall constitute tender of his expenses in respect of any travelling required; and (b) the tender of a written undertaking by the court administration officer to defray any other expenses payable under these Rules shall constitute tender in respect of those expenses.
